How to remove front indicators?
So I bought some led lamps for the front headlamp indicators to replace the stock orange bulb.
I cannot get the OEM lamp out. The panel on the wheel arch comes off easy, then the indicator turns about 30 degrees and stops. Has anyone else done this that can tell me if I need to turn harder or? (I've not tried this as I don't want to snap anything) EDIT I've sussed this now. Just needed to pull harder! The Result: Last edited by ManiacGT; 08-26-2013 at 02:53 AM.. |

The main reason I changed this was not to change colour, that would be illegal in the UK. This was to make the blinking of the light instant, not fade in and out like a normal bulb does. This then matches the rest of the car as the side repeaters and rear indicators/turn signals are LED and are instant off/on. Now too are the front indicators which BMW were too cheap to make LED and put normal bulbs in. They're also somewhat brighter, which can only be a good thing when it comes to indication.

Easy peasy Japanesey. The flap in the wheel well is removed by turning the 2 hold-down tabs with a quarter. Turn the tab on the bulb assembly (it only goes about 1/4 turn and stops), then grab the tab with a pair of pliers and pull. The bulb is attached to a base which rotates about 1/4 turn and pulls off. Just reverse to re-assemble.

CA vehicle code
V C Section 24953 Turn Signal Lamps
Turn Signal Lamps 24953.**(a) Any turn signal system used to give a signal of intention to turn right or left shall project a flashing white or amber light visible to the front and a flashing red or amber light visible to the rear. white is alright!
